From small commercial properties to multi-building campuses, we design and install the right system for your application and budget.
Cost-effective zone-based systems ideal for smaller buildings. Devices are grouped by zone so responders can quickly identify the affected area during an alarm.
Each device has a unique address, giving operators pinpoint location of every detector, pull station, and notification device. Mandatory for larger and complex buildings per NFPA 72.
Radio-frequency devices eliminate the need for extensive wire runs — ideal for historic buildings, occupied retrofits, or locations where trenching is impractical or cost-prohibitive.

Fire alarm systems in California are governed by multiple overlapping codes. Delta handles compliance for all of them — so you don't need to.
The primary national standard governing fire alarm installation, inspection, testing, and maintenance. All Delta installations are NFPA 72 compliant.
California's State Fire Marshal regulations for fire alarm systems in public buildings. Requires annual inspections and certified technicians.
Governs fire alarm requirements for new construction, tenant improvements, and change-of-occupancy projects throughout California.
Local fire departments enforce CFC requirements for fire detection and alarm systems. We coordinate directly with your local AHJ for permit approvals and final inspections.
All fire alarm equipment installed by Delta is CSFM-listed, as required for use in California commercial buildings.
